Large (Clark Art Museum)
Carron Iron Works, painted around 1800 and attributed to Joseph Mallord William Turner, certainly demonstrates all of his usual verve.
Fire and smoke pour upwards, while the reflection in the water below looks almost auroral.
Yet what it depicts is fairly pedestrian—an iron works, the name of which still decorates the bottom of many a British post box.
